Output eec6cdff2529debbee1d17824dfa167865155504145184af3e380af3d45a90aa:0

value
595753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b3399b60be8515b2a1fdcf48d595078f656468 OP_EQUAL
address
3DyFB2F2Mi19YT9KzkrpEjNwcfuCgdtTZA
transaction
eec6cdff2529debbee1d17824dfa167865155504145184af3e380af3d45a90aa
spent
true